Output ecc650b1fbc26f40facf0bcb430fe26237dc0d896b5ebfc16baa66dbabec4e82:1

value
1595560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3266ac16882a217a440facca941e5d5e8a16e4be OP_EQUAL
address
36HWhvffA8vZESKzy86nRVGWAU1FUSQBMB
transaction
ecc650b1fbc26f40facf0bcb430fe26237dc0d896b5ebfc16baa66dbabec4e82
spent
true